ABOUT CORE LEADERSHIP:

Core Leadership is a 501(c)(3) and was founded to address the unique challenges faced by first responders in accessing professional development. The demanding hours, financial barriers, and societal stigmas often prevent first responders from receiving the same opportunities for growth and leadership development as leaders in other fields, such as those in Fortune 100 companies.

Our mission extends beyond first responders; we believe civilians also benefit from development opportunities that enhance understanding, build empathy, and strengthen relationships with those who serve their communities. By offering programs designed to bridge these divides, Core Leadership works to create environments where trust and respect flourish.

Through evidence-based training approaches and community collaboration, Core Leadership equips first responders and civilians with the skills to lead courageously, communicate effectively, and build stronger, more compassionate communities together.
